Made my own baby legs


A few weeks ago, I ordered some "baby legs" (baby leg warmers) for W's Halloween costume (couldn't find yellow and black striped socks in town, so I couldn't attempt making them myself!). This weekend we went to Value Village and I found some rainbow striped knee-high in the little girls department - 69 cents! Woo hoo!

I've seen different tutorials for these and some are more complicated than others. I've seen some where you cut each sock into 4 pieces and sew some of them back on to create cuffs - but that seems unnecessarily complicated to me - I just cut the foot part off and folded the fabric down to make a new cuff at the bottom (which then became the top of the leg warmer).
